Guanghui Energy (600256) Q1 2025 earnings summary
Event summary combining transcript, slides, and related documents.
Q1 2025 earnings summary
6 Jun, 2025Executive summary
Q1 2025 revenue was RMB 8.90 billion, down 11.34% year-over-year; net profit attributable to shareholders was RMB 693.87 million, down 14.07%.
Operating cash flow decreased 55.94% year-over-year to RMB 753.72 million, mainly due to lower sales volumes and coal prices, and increased receivables.
The company maintained a focus on safety, efficiency, and innovation amid weak market demand and falling commodity prices.
Financial highlights
Revenue: RMB 8.90 billion (down 11.34% YoY); net profit: RMB 693.87 million (down 14.07% YoY); EPS: RMB 0.1057 (down 14.07% YoY).
Operating cash flow: RMB 753.72 million (down 55.94% YoY); total assets: RMB 56.40 billion (down 0.77% from year-end 2024).
Net assets attributable to shareholders: RMB 27.68 billion (up 2.57% from year-end 2024).
Gross margin: RMB 1.82 billion (calculated from revenue and cost); net margin: 7.8%.
Adjusted net profit (excluding non-recurring items): RMB 700.90 million (down 9.48% YoY).
Outlook and guidance
The company aims to strengthen core operations, enhance management, and accelerate innovation to improve stability and sustainability.
Macroeconomic headwinds and weak demand for coal and energy products are expected to persist, with continued pressure on prices.
